At noon on June 3, the plane carrying Australian Prime Minister Anthony Albanese and the Australian delegation landed at Noi Bai Airport (Hanoi), starting an official visit to Vietnam from June 3-4, 2023 at the invitation of Prime Minister Pham Minh Chinh.

Minister and Chairman of the Government Office Tran Van Son welcomed Australian Prime Minister Anthony Albanese at Noi Bai International Airport. (Source: VNA)

This is Mr. Anthony Albanese's first official visit to Vietnam since taking office and just 2 months after the state visit of Australian Governor-General David Hurley, demonstrating Australia's importance in relations with Vietnam.

Welcoming the delegation at the airport were Minister and Head of the Government Office Tran Van Son; Deputy Minister of Foreign Affairs Do Hung Viet; leaders of the Southeast Asia-South Asia-South Pacific Department, Department of State Protocol (Ministry of Foreign Affairs); Australian Ambassador to Vietnam and a number of officials from the Australian Embassy in Hanoi.

Accompanying Prime Minister Anthony Albanese on his visit to Vietnam were: Chief of the Prime Minister's Office Tim Gartrell, International Affairs Adviser Kathy Klugman, Director of International Affairs Craig Chittick, Director of Digital Affairs Austin Phillips, National Security and International Affairs Adviser Hayley Limbrick, and Southeast Asia Affairs Adviser Jessica Bowen-Thomas.

During the visit, Australian Prime Minister Anthony Albanese and the Australian delegation will lay wreaths and visit President Ho Chi Minh's Mausoleum; attend the official welcoming ceremony; have a meeting between the two Prime Ministers; hold talks; exchange documents; meet the press; meet with General Secretary Nguyen Phu Trong, President Vo Van Thuong, and National Assembly Chairman Vuong Dinh Hue; visit and interact with the Australian and Vietnamese women's football teams with Prime Minister Pham Minh Chinh; and attend an official reception.

Deputy Foreign Minister Do Hung Viet participated in welcoming the Australian Prime Minister to Hanoi, beginning an official visit to Vietnam.

It is expected that Australian Prime Minister Anthony Albanese will have a number of sideline activities such as visiting and enjoying Hanoi's culinary arts; visiting RMIT University; and visiting the United Nations International School of Hanoi (UNIS).

The official visit to Vietnam by Australian Prime Minister Anthony Albanese from June 3-4 will continue to contribute to strengthening political trust and promoting multi-faceted cooperation in politics-diplomacy, defense-security, economy, investment, labor, education, technology, climate change, and people-to-people exchange between Vietnam and Australia.

Mr. Anthony Norman Albanese is the 31st Prime Minister of Australia. He was born on March 2, 1963 in Sydney, New South Wales, Australia; education: Bachelor of Economics, University of Sydney, Australia.

Career: From December 2006 to December 2007, he was Shadow Minister, Ministry of Water Resources and Infrastructure. From December 2007 to September 2013, he was Shadow Minister, Ministry of Infrastructure, Transport, Regional Development and Local Government. From October 2013 to June 2019, he was Shadow Minister, Ministry of Tourism.

From September 2014 to July 2016, he was Shadow Minister, Ministry of Cities. From July 2016 to June 2019, he was Shadow Minister, Ministry of Infrastructure, Cities and Regional Development.

From May 2019 to May 2022, he served as Leader of the Opposition. From May 23, 2022 to present, he has been Prime Minister of Australia.

As one of Australia's longest-serving politicians, Anthony Albanese has built a reputation as a "builder" with a message of connection and unity.

During his campaign and inaugural address, he emphasized his commitment to changing policies on the environment, climate change, and clean energy.
